Job summary
We are seeking a Trust Assurance Specialist to join the Trust Office team at DigiCert. This role is responsible for owning defined compliance and assurance areas, including audit execution, control management, and regulatory alignment.
The successful candidate will have a minimum of 5 years of experience in compliance, risk management, or audit, with the ability to independently manage audit and control activities and engage stakeholders across the organization.
This role reports to the Head of Compliance and works closely with cross-functional teams across Security, IT, Legal, and Operations.
What you will do
Audit & Assurance Support
- Own and manage assigned external (e.g., SOC 2, WebTrust) and customer audits
- Plan audit activities, coordinate stakeholders, and ensure timely delivery of evidence
- Track, manage, and drive remediation of audit findings
Regulatory Compliance
- Ensure ongoing compliance within assigned frameworks (e.g., WebTrust for CAs, SOC 2, ISO 27001, NIST)
- Interpret regulatory requirements and ensure controls align with both regulatory expectations and internal policy frameworks
Control Management
- Design, document, and evaluate controls to ensure effectiveness and compliance
- Perform and oversee control testing within assigned areas
- Identify control gaps and drive remediation efforts
Risk & Governance Support
- Provide input into risk assessments and support broader risk management activities.
- Assist in maintaining compliance documentation and reporting.
Stakeholder Collaboration
- Partner with internal teams (Security, IT, Legal, HR, Operations) to support compliance initiatives.
- Act as a point of contact for audit-related queries within assigned areas.
Continuous Improvement
- Stay informed on relevant regulatory and industry developments.
- Identify opportunities to improve compliance processes, tools, and reporting.
General
- Support a culture of compliance and security awareness across the organization.
- Perform other related duties as assigned.
What you will have
- Bachelor’s degree in Law, Compliance, Information Security, Computer Science, or a related field
- Minimum 5 years of experience in compliance, risk management, audit, or related roles
- Experience managing audits and working with frameworks such as SOC 2, ISO 27001, WebTrust, or NIST
- Experience in control design, documentation, and testing
- Strong analytical and problem-solving skills
- Excellent communication and stakeholder management skills
- Ability to work independently and manage multiple priorities
Nice to have
- Exposure to PKI, cybersecurity, or cloud environments
- Progress toward or attainment of certifications such as CISA, CISM, CRISC, or CISSP
